KanBo in Action – Step-by-Step Manual

KanBo Manual: Data Strategy Framework

1. Starting Point

When Maria, the Data Strategy Manager, starts her project to optimize inventory across store locations, she needs a centralized platform. In KanBo, she should create a Workspace specifically for the Inventory Optimization Project. Within this Workspace, she will create different Spaces such as "Data Gathering," "Trend Analysis," and "Implementation Coordination." This structure will allow for organized management of tasks and data.

2. Building Workflows with Statuses and Roles

To efficiently manage the process, Maria needs to establish clear workflows:

- Statuses: Define stages such as "Data Collection," "Analysis In Progress," "Strategy Drafting," and "Review & Implementation."

- Roles: Assign a Responsible Person for each card to ensure task ownership. Use Co-Workers for collaborative tasks like data analysis, and assign Visitors to stakeholders who need insight but not direct involvement.

- Clear transitions between statuses, combined with defined roles, ensure transparency and accountability as the team progresses through the data strategy workflow.

3. Creating and Organizing Work

Begin by creating Cards for key tasks such as "Collect Sales Data from Store A" or "Analyze Seasonal Trends." For tasks that are interconnected, like data dependency, use Card Relations. If the same task applies to multiple Spaces, leverage Mirror Cards to maintain consistency without duplication.

4. Tracking Progress

Use a mix of Views to track progress effectively:

- Kanban View: Monitor task status in a visual board format.

- Gantt Chart: Plan long-term tasks requiring data dependencies.

- Timeline View: Visualize chronological progress and ensure tasks align with project timelines.

- Forecast Chart: Project future task completion to adjust strategies proactively.

- Regularly interpreting these views ensures Maria and the team can adapt promptly and make informed decisions.

5. Adjusting Views with Filters

When overwhelmed by large data sets:

- Filter by Responsible Person, Status, or Labels to streamline what’s visible.

- Combine Filters with personal space views to tailor your daily focus on critical tasks.

- In larger Spaces, this approach reduces noise and enhances focus, ensuring Maria only sees the most relevant information.

6. Collaboration in Context

Facilitate clear communication by using:

- Comments and Mentions directly on Cards to reduce email clutter.

- The Activity Stream for all team members to stay updated with real-time actions and decisions.

- Escalate blockers directly on Cards to quickly address issues that impede progress.

7. Documents & Knowledge

Keep all necessary documents accessible:

- Attach essential files to Card Documents.

- Use Document Sources to link broader resource libraries relevant to data strategies.

- Ensure document consistency by creating and using Document Templates for repetitive report formats or data analysis frameworks.

8. Troubleshooting & Governance

When encountering issues or discrepancies:

- Check Filters and Views: Ensure correct filter settings are applied and views are not overly restricted.

- Verify Permissions: Make sure team roles and access levels are correctly set, especially when team members cannot access certain Spaces or Cards.

- Sync Issues: Confirm all systems are properly integrated and syncing in real-time to avoid outdated data being used in decision-making.
